Townhomes Insurance Coverage

As a town home community the Association only carries liability insurance on the common areas. Your unit is NOT insured by the HOA. As a homeowner, you own the structure of the townhome and are responsible for insurance on your unit to cover the dwelling and personal property contents in the event of fire or destruction by obtaining an HO-3 policy. Please contact your insurance agent to make sure you have the correct type of policy coverage.

Architectural Control Requests

The governing documents stipulate that all any exterior changes or additions must be submitted in writing to the HOA and must be approved by the HOA before any work can begin. This includes, but is not limited to:  installation of sheds, fences, patios, decks, extended driveways, conversion of patio into sunroom, room additions, satellite dishes, installing or removing landscaping (not including seasonal flowers), roof replacement if changing shingle color, siding replacement if changing siding type or color, window replacement, addition of storm doors, installation of solar panels, painting of doors, shutters, windows or siding, etc. If you have a question about if your project requires Architectural Approval please contact our office and we will be happy to answer any questions about your specific project.  Submit your Architectural Request by visiting the Forms Page.
